
Mittagong public school has 512 students (as of 08/05/2024). The school has 20 mainstream classes and 3 support classes. The support classes are IM (mild intellectual disabilty), and MC (Multi categorical).
There are 32 teachers and a part time school counsellor. The teachers of the 3 support classes are assisted by full time School Learning Support Officers. The school has a permanent administrative manager, 2 administrative officers (admin 5 days) and a full time general assistant. There are 6 part time School Learning Support Officers who assist with the integration of students with special needs within mainstream classes.
New enrolments are always welcome for students residing in the school's local enrolment area. This area includes all of the town of Mittagong, and adjoining villages of Welby, Willow Vale, Balaclava, Natti Ponds, Renwick and Braemar as well as the surrounding rural areas. Students residing to the west of Mittagong along Wombeyan Caves Road and surrounds are also included in the school's local enrolment zone. Families living in other areas may apply for non-local enrolment. A special non-local enrolment application form for special consideration for a place at the school needs to be completed.

Mittagong Public School offers outstanding opportunities for student learning in a caring and supportive environment. The school has dedicated, experienced teachers. Our classroom programs have a strong academic emphasis with high standards achieved by many students. We also have a proud tradition of emphasis on performing arts and sporting success.
Parents are encouraged to be involved with their childrens progress at every level. This includes involvement in classroom, sporting and social activities as well as in policy and decision making through the P&C and School Council. Parents support healthy food choices for children by running a successful canteen.
Our school has a focus on providing individualised programs for students with special needs as well as enrichment and extension to inspire and challenge students.
The school boasts spacious, attractive grounds with up to date technology resources and a well-resourced, stimulating library. Excellent facilities like the assembly hall, covered areas and kitchen/craft room provide opportunities for special activities for students.
